101212(b) · 101212(b)Reporting Requirements (b) The name of the child care center director, and any fully qualified teacher(s) designated to act in the child care center director's absence, shall be reported to the Department within 10 days of a change of child care center director or designee(s).
Director returned to oversee faciilty as of October 2, 2023. Based on observations and interviews, interim director was not reported to the the department for the 5 months that the director was not present, which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care. 101238(a) · 101238(a) Buildings and Grounds (a) The child care center shall be clean, safe, sanitary and in good repair at all times to ensure the safety and well-being of children, employees and visitors.
Per Director, Owner has been contacted and repairs will be made on or before 3/8/2024. Visit will be scheduled to observe repairs made. Based on observations,facility is in unsafe and in need of repair, which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

101238(a)(1) · 101238(a)(1)The child care center shall be clean, safe, sanitary and in good repair at all times to ensure the safety and well-being of children, employees and visitors. (1) The licensee shall take measures to keep the center free of flies, other insects, and rodents. The Director provided LPA Clayton with invoices for continuing exterminator/pest control services to mitigate the insect problem. LPA instruced Director to submit future invoices to the ESRO.
Based on LPA interviews with staff and children, who disclosed that there was an ongoing pest/cockroach issue, which poses immediate Health and Safety risks to children in care

101223(a)(3) · 101223(a)(3)(a) The licensee shall ensure that each child is accorded the following personal rights:(3) To be free from corporal or unusual punishment, infliction of pain, humiliation, intimidation, ridicule, coercion, threat, mental abuse or other actions of a punitive nature including but not limited to: interference with functions of daily living including eating, sleeping or toileting; or withholding of shelter, clothing, medication or aids to physical functioning. Director instructed to conduct training with all staff regarding personal rights and reporting requirements.
Based on LPA interviews with staff who told a child in care, in front of other children, that if he did not behave, the bugs would come back. Which poses a Personal Rights risks to children in care Director will provide a copy of the training agenda along with the Staff attendee signature via email no later than 10/27/2022.
